Promoting Honest and Ethical Conduct

Liberty Media Corporation exhibits and promotes the highest standards of honest and ethical conduct in all our dealings relating to the business of the Company. That means, among other things, that we will work to develop business relationships through open and honest communications. No one should take unfair advantage of another through manipulation, concealment, or abuse of privileged information, misrepresentation of material facts, or any other unfair practice.

Reporting Illegal or Unethical Behavior

Each employee has the right and the obligation to seek and obtain guidance about a compliance issue or business practice. Employees should contact the appropriate Corporate Compliance Contact Person concerning observed illegal or unethical behavior. Employees also may discuss these matters with an immediate supervisor or other manager, a human resources manager, or the legal department of their business unit.

No Retaliation

The Company will not permit retaliation against any employee who, in good faith, seeks advice concerning, or who reports or complains of violations of, this Code or other illegal or unethical conduct. If, however, an employee makes a false report of a violation or of questionable behavior for the purpose of harming another person, the reporting employee will be subject to disciplinary action.

How to Ask Questions and Communicate Concerns

If you want guidance regarding a particular practice or compliance issue, or if you wish to report a violation or questionable behavior, you should contact your Corporate Compliance Contact Person. The Corporate Compliance Contact Person will be different for various employees, but generally will be a person in the legal department of your business unit or, in the absence of a more specific designation, the Chief Legal Officer of Liberty Media Corporation or a person designated by that officer. If you want to contact your Corporate Compliance Contact Person but are not sure of his or her identity, you should contact the legal department of your business unit or the Chief Legal Officer of Liberty Media Corporation for that information.

You may also call the Liberty Compliance Line at (866) 222-1232 if you are calling from a location within the United States or Canada. The Liberty Compliance Line is operated by a third-party vendor and is available 24 hours a day, seven days a week. Your calls will be taken in confidence and your concerns reported to Company personnel for appropriate action. Your calls to the Liberty Compliance Line may be made on an anonymous basis.

If you wish to communicate via a confidential web-based reporting system, you may contact the third-party vendor at: liberty.tnwreports.com.

Your identity will be kept confidential, and your concerns reported to Company personnel for appropriate action.

You may also send a letter or fax to the Chief Legal Officer at Liberty Media Corporation, 12300 Liberty Boulevard, Englewood, Colorado 80112, fax number (720) 875-5382. Letters and faxes may be submitted anonymously.
